Now that env_get_ip() has been removed, the include file &lt;net.h&gt; does
not need anything from &lt;env.h&gt;. Furthermore, include/env.h itself
includes other headers which can lead to longer indirect inclusion
paths. To prepare to remove &lt;env.h&gt; from &lt;net.h&gt; fix all of the
remaining places which had relied on this indirect inclusion to instead
include &lt;env.h&gt; directly.

This follows the example of RISC-V where &lt;asm/global_data.h&gt; includes
&lt;asm/u-boot.h&gt; directly as "gd" includes a reference to bd_info already
and so the first must include the second anyhow. We then remove
&lt;asm/u-boot.h&gt; from all of the places which include references to "gd"
an so have &lt;asm/global_data.h&gt; already.

Add a new event which handles this function. Convert existing use of
the function to use the new event instead.

Make sure that EVENT is enabled by affected boards, by selecting it from
the LAST_STAGE_INIT option. For x86, enable it by default since all boards
need it.

For controlcenterdc, inline the get_tpm() function and make sure the event
is not built in SPL.
